Output 372bd694795b4dd090ae6d485f22256ecca86330d6d706cb628bfaa4a4e66633:42

value
58132092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ab863ecc555f6fda208a199c371f65b20ceb96be OP_EQUAL
address
MPY6bm4gEJjVwdP9tQpMaa4AETDtZ8zLwe
transaction
372bd694795b4dd090ae6d485f22256ecca86330d6d706cb628bfaa4a4e66633
spent
true